- The distance between Elat’Ma, Russia and Nar’Jan-Mar, Russia is approximately 1,527 km or 949 mi.
- To reach Elat’Ma in this distance one would set out from Nar’Jan-Mar bearing 208.2°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Elat’Ma bearing 198.2° or SSW .
- Elat’Ma has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Nar’Jan-Mar has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Elat’Ma is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Nar’Jan-Mar is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.1 °C (14.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.5 °C (4.5°F) less in Elat’Ma.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 182.3 mm (7.2 in) more which is equivalent to 182.3 l/m² (4.47 US gal/ft²) or 1,823,000 l/ha (194,891 US gal/ac) more. About 1 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.6° higher in Elat’Ma than in Nar’Jan-Mar.
